Insurance To be successful electricians must be protected by the right insurance. This includes a variety of policies that will protect the business from both injuries and property damage claims. General Liability Insurance is an insurance policy that every small business owner should have. It covers legal defense costs when customers or clients file a lawsuit against you for personal injuries or property damage. You can also make use of it to pay medical expenses and compensation in the event that your client sues you following being injured at work. Commercial Auto Coverage covers damages or losses to a vehicle that is used by an electrical contractor in the course of business. It also covers responsibility in the event drivers are found guilty of driving while under the influence. Public Liability Insurance is an essential insurance electricians should have. It provides financial protection for legal claims a client or the general public can file against an electrical contractor due to an accident, damage or theft. Cyber Liability Coverage Another insurance option for electricians when they are responsible for installing or servicing security systems. It covers the costs of repair and legal liability if there is a data breach in your business. Electrical contractors who employ employees must purchase workers' compensation insurance. It can pay for medical costs as well as disability benefits and wage replacement in the event that an employee is injured while at work. You are also protected from lawsuits that are brought by employees who are disgruntled and feels that they have been wronged, or discriminated against. Turning off the electricity before starting a project is one of the most important elements to electrical safety. This is a simple but effective method to ensure your safety. When working with electricity, it can be beneficial to have a number in case of emergency. This will ensure that if something happens, you will be able to get in touch with a professional immediately and they can come out to help. Another crucial aspect of electrical security is keeping records of maintenance. This will allow you to keep in check the state of your electrical installation and ensure that it is compliant with all the laws applicable to it. Additionally in addition, you should make sure that all portable electrical equipment is tested and safe to use. This is a process known as PAT testing, and it's the best way to minimize the chance of electrical accidents and fires in your workplace. Private landlords in England and Wales are legally required to make sure that their properties are safe for electrical use. The law requires that all electrical installations be inspected and maintained at least once every five years. You can do this by obtaining an assessment of the condition of the electrical installation. The report will show whether the installation is adequate for continuous use. If it's not satisfactory then remedial measures are needed. In April, landlords will be forced to conduct these inspections according to new regulations. This will likely lead to an increased demand for electricians as landlords will have to pay for inspections of their properties. Tools An electrician needs a diverse range of tools to help them complete their job which ranges from basic hand tools to special electrical tools. These tools can be used to perform a wide range of tasks, including disassembling old equipment and connecting new wires and devices. A hammer for example is an essential instrument for securing a new electrical cable to framing members within homes. It can also be used to drive wire staples installing a new outlet or switch. It is essential for electricians to be capable of working in dark, restricted spaces. These flashlights are especially helpful for electricians working in attics, basements or other dark places where electrical wiring may be concealed. Another tool electricians use is a volt tester. Non-contact testers are used to determine the safety of a project prior to beginning work. They are cost-effective and easy to use. Screwdrivers come in various lengths and sizes. They can be used for removing and installing cover plates and outlets, switches and many other devices. These are available with insulated handles that provide safer handling when cutting or working with wires. They are available at many home centers and electrical supply stores. Straight-bladed screwdrivers can be used for most jobs. A tool kit for pliers is essential for any electrician. It should contain needle-nose or long-nose side-cutting, reaming, and side-cutting tools. Needle-nose pliers are ideal for grasping, twisting and cutting wires; side-cutting tools are ideal for navigating tight spaces to cut wires and reaming tools can be used to tighten locknuts, fittings and caps. Wire stripping tools are useful for exposing copper connections between wires and another part, such as the light fixture.
